As of the 1st February 2025, PLSclear will be introducing a new policy in addition to our regular credit control work. Licences which have been paid for via invoice and are unpaid for over a year will be cancelled, if no payment is made.
Once a user has accepted a quote by invoice, they are provided with their licence document. PLS then issue invoices to the requestor and their organisation’s finance contact. The validity of the licence is dependent on its Terms and Conditions, which includes the payment of any licence fees owed.
If no payment is made for a licence, it is, therefore, invalid.
As part of our usual credit control procedures, these requestors are contacted regularly and reminded to pay the licence fee due.
As part of the new policy, requestors will receive a final chaser and will be advised their licence will be cancelled if payment is not received by a due date.
For any cancelled requests in your account, we will make it clear that cancellation is due to non-payment and if they still need the content, the requestor will need to resubmit the request. You will see this as a comment on the relevant request.
